How Should You Maintain Your Beard Close Trimmer for Longevity?

To ensure the longevity of your best beard close trimmer, proper maintenance is essential.

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ping the trimmer clean is crucial for optimal performance and hygiene. After each use, remove hair clippings with a brush, and periodically wash detachable blades with warm water and mild soap to prevent buildup.
  • Blade Oiling: Regularly oiling the blades will reduce friction and wear, ensuring a smoother cut. A few drops of trimmer oil applied to the blades will keep them lubricated and prevent rust or corrosion.
  • Battery Care: If your trimmer is cordless, proper battery maintenance is vital for longevity. Always fully charge the battery before use and avoid letting it completely drain to extend its lifespan.
  • Storage: Proper storage can protect your trimmer from damage. Store it in a cool, dry place, ideally in a protective case, to avoid impacts and exposure to moisture that could harm the internal components.
  • Replacement Parts: Over time, parts like blades and guards may wear out. Regularly check these components for signs of damage or dullness and replace them as needed to maintain cutting efficiency.

What Are the Common Mistakes to Avoid When Choosing a Beard Close Trimmer?

When selecting the best beard close trimmer, avoiding common mistakes can significantly enhance your grooming experience.

  • Choosing the wrong blade material: Many trimmers feature blades made from various materials like stainless steel, ceramic, or carbon. Stainless steel is durable and resistant to rust, while ceramic blades tend to stay sharper longer and produce less friction, which can be beneficial for sensitive skin.
  • Ignoring battery life: Battery life is crucial for cordless trimmers, as a short battery duration can interrupt your grooming sessions. Look for models that offer long-lasting batteries or quick charge capabilities to ensure you can always maintain your beard without interruptions.
  • Overlooking maintenance requirements: Some trimmers require more maintenance than others, such as regular oiling or cleaning. Choosing a low-maintenance option can save you time and effort, allowing you to focus more on your grooming routine rather than upkeep.
  • Not considering the adjustable length settings: Trimmers with fixed length settings may not provide the versatility needed for different styles. Opt for a trimmer with multiple adjustable settings to easily achieve various beard lengths and styles tailored to your preference.
  • Neglecting ergonomics and design: The design and comfort of the trimmer can greatly affect usability. A well-designed trimmer that fits comfortably in your hand will make it easier to maneuver and reach all areas of your beard, reducing the risk of nicks and cuts.
  • Failing to check for additional features: Many trimmers come with added features like waterproofing, LED indicators, or attachments for different grooming needs. These features can enhance your grooming experience, making it more efficient and tailored to your needs.
